\section{Lines of intersecting planes}

For every object of the type \bs{psSolid}, it is possible to draw the lines 
of intersection between a chosen solid and one or more planes.

The numeric argument \texttt{[intersectiontype=$k$]} (value $-1$ by default) 
determines whether or not to draw the intersection lines. Set to $0$, the 
intersection lines are drawn.

There are three keys to be handled:

\begin{itemize}

\item \texttt{[intersectionplan=\{[$eq_1$] ... [$eq_n$]\}]}
defines a list of the equations $eq_i$ of the intersecting planes. The $eq_i$
could as well be some objects from the type \Cadre{plan} (see the related section).
\begin{equation*}
  ax+by+cz+d=0    \qquad \text{that would deliver $[a\, b\, c\, d\,]$ as one of the $n$ equations}
\end{equation*}

\item \texttt{[intersectionlinewidth=$w_1$ ... $w_n$]}
defines a list of the thickness in picas $w_i$ for each of the intersection lines.

\item \texttt{[intersectioncolor=color$_1$ ... color$_n$]}
defines a list for the colors of the intersection lines.

\end{itemize}

\begin{LTXexample}[width=6cm]
\psset{lightsrc=20 -20 10,viewpoint=50 -20 10 rtp2xyz,Decran=50}
\psset{unit=0.5}
\begin{pspicture*}(-5,-4)(5,5)
\psSolid[object=cube,
   intersectiontype=0,
   intersectionplan={[1 0 .5 2] [1 0 .5 -1]},
   intersectionlinewidth=1 2,
   intersectioncolor=(bleu) (rouge),
   RotX=20,RotY=90,RotZ=30,
   a=6,
   action=draw*]
\end{pspicture*}
\end{LTXexample}
